Elizabeth Hurley is a British actress, producer, model and fashion designer. She has starred in films such as Austin Powers: International Man of Mystery and has been a spokeswoman for cosmetics brand Estée Lauder since 1994. She fronted their advertising campaigns for seven years, before American supermodel Carolyn Murphy took over in 2001.http://www.guardian.co.uk/lifeandstyle/2006/jan/15/features.woman9
In 2001, Hurley and then-lover Steve Bing were involved in a publicized paternity dispute over her first child Damien. The dispute started when a friend of Hurley's leaked to the press that she was pregnant with her first child and the child was Bing's.http://www.guardian.co.uk/world/2001/dec/11/gender.uk1 Millionaire Bing publicly denied the baby was his and said that he and Hurley had not been in an "exclusive" relationship.http://www.guardian.co.uk/world/2001/dec/11/gender.uk1 The couple's child was born on April 4, 2002. That month Bing began legal proceedings to determine whether he was the father. In June, 2002, DNA tests found Bing was the father. The matter was settled in the High Court of London.http://www.cbsnews.com/stories/2002/06/19/entertainment/main512777.shtml
Elizabeth Hurley's Career
After graduating from the London Studio Centre, Elizabeth Hurley made her film debut in Aria. The film gained official selection in the 1987 Cannes Film Festival.http://www.festival-cannes.com/en/archives/ficheFilm/id/410/year/1987.html She starred in several British television and film shows during the late 1980s. During this time she also started her romance with British film star Hugh Grant. Hurley made her first Hollywood movie when she starred alongside Wesley Snipes in Passenger 57. In 1995, Hurley's relationship with Grant came under the media spotlight when he was caught with a prostitute in Los Angeles.http://www.telegraph.co.uk/news/1471976/Hugh-Grant-on-prostitute-charge.html In the late 90s Hurley continued making films including Austin Powers: International Man of Mystery and the 1999 follow-up, The Spy Who Shagged Me. Her film career continued in the 2000s, with roles alongside Brendan Fraser in Bedazzled and Matthew Perry in Serving Sara.http://www.imdb.com/name/nm0000167/ Due to be released in 2010, animated film The Wild Bunch will be Hurley's first film role in six years.http://www.imdb.com/name/nm0000167/
During her acting career Hurley has also worked as a model, producer and launched her own swimwear line. She has been the international face for cosmetics company Estée Lauder and appreared on the reality television show Project Catwalk.http://www.guardian.co.uk/lifeandstyle/2006/jan/15/features.woman9 She is currently involved in the production and sale of her own organic food and her own swimwear label, Elizabeth Hurley Beach.http://www.elizabethhurley.com/
